Different Ways to Own an RV

Owning an RV doesn’t always mean paying the full price upfront. Depending on your lifestyle and budget, there are several options to explore:

1. Traditional Purchase (New or Used)

Buying an RV outright is a great option if you have the savings or financing in place. You can find a wide range of models—motorhomes, fifth wheels, travel trailers, and camper vans—at dealerships and private sellers.

  • New RVs offer the latest features, warranties, and modern tech
  • Used motorhomes are more budget-friendly and often come with helpful upgrades from previous owners

3. RV Financing

Financing through a bank, credit union, or RV lender is one of the most common ways to own an RV. Loan terms can range from a few years to 15+ years, depending on the type and price of the RV.

Tip: Always compare interest rates, down payment requirements, and monthly payments to find the best fit.

Rent-to-own programs allow you to make rental payments that contribute toward eventual ownership. It’s an appealing choice if you want to test out RV life before fully committing. Some programs also include flexible return or upgrade options.

5. Shared Ownership or Co-Ownership

In this model, multiple families or friends go in on an RV together and share usage throughout the year. While less common, this is a creative way to split costs and maintenance while still enjoying the RV lifestyle.

Choosing the Right RV for Your Needs

If you're just starting out, here are a few things to consider:

  • Size and layout – Do you want a compact campervan or a spacious Class A motorhome?
  • Driving comfort – Some people prefer towable trailers, while others want a self-contained motorhome
  • Features – Look for must-haves like full bathrooms, slide-outs, kitchen setups, and storage
